Internal probe clears IPL teams, officials

2013-07-30
NEW DELHI, July 29: An internal Indian cricket board panel investigating allegations of spot fixing during this year`s Indian Premier League has reportedly cleared two teams and its officials.

`The report mentioned that no concrete evidence was found against CSK (Chennai Super Kings), Rajasthan Royals, (Chennai team principal) Gurunath Meiyappan and royals coowner Raj Kundra as far as their involvement in fixing was concerned,` Board of Control for Cricket in India treasurer Ravi Savant was quoted as saying in Monday`s The Indian Express.

The details of the report submitted by the two-member panel comprising former judges Jayaram Chouta and R. Balasubramanian were not shared with the media and will be discussed at an IPL governing council meeting on Aug 2 for a decision on whether to revoke the suspensions of the two officials.-AP
